The Teacher of Cosmetology assists with implementing the New Jersey Department of Education Core Curriculum Content Standards while providing a well-developed high school level program in Cosmetology/Hairstyling for classified pupils. Qualifications:

Education,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Required:

  1. NJDOE Teacher of Production, Personal or Service Occupations: Cosmetologist/Hairstylist & New Jersey State Board of Cosmetology & Hairstyling License or NJDOE Teacher of Production, Personal or Service Occupations: Cosmetologist/Hairstylist CE/CEAS and willingness to obtain as appropriate & willingness to obtain New Jersey State Board of Cosmetology & Hairstyling License
  2. NJDOE Criminal History Review.
  3.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  4. Proficient computer skills that may include but are not limited to Microsoft Office and/or Google Suite platforms.

Education,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Preferred:

  1. Bachelor's Degree.
  2. Minimum of three (3) years' experience working as a Teacher.

Licenses and Certifications Required:

  1. NJDOE Teacher of Production, Personal of Service Occupations Cosmetologist Hairstylist or Teacher of Prod Personal Serv Occup Cosmetologist Hairstylist Certificate Eligibility. Willingness to obtain New Jersey State Board of Cosmetology & Hairstyling License.
